PTE (Pearson Test of Language)/Pearson Test of Language is a unit of the Pearson PLC group, dedicated to assessing and validating the English language usage of non-native English speakers. The tests include PTE Academic, PTE General (formerly known as London Tests of English) and PTE Young Learners. These are scenario-based exams, accredited by the QCA, Ofqual,[rx] and administered in association with Edexcel, the world’s largest examining body.[rx]

The PTE Academic exam is a computer-based English language test accepted by educational institutions around the world. Those students and aspirants who desire to go abroad for studying or immigration to a major English speaking country are required to take the PTE Academic exam to prove their English language competency.

The three-hour-long computer-based test focusses on day to day English rather than high-level English language and tests a student on his/her ability to effectively understand the language as spoken daily. The multi-level grading system ensures a better understanding of the student’s proficiency in the English language.

There are many things that distinguish PTE Academic from its close competitors – IELTS and TOEFL. The first and foremost distinguishing aspect of the same is the scoring pattern and the results. As the tests are completely computerized, the PTE results and scores are declared much quicker, typically in 5 business days. This makes it aptly suited for students who are in a bit of a rush. Types of PTE

PTE General

Pearson Test of English General (PTE General) formerly recognized as London Tests of English General. PTE General Test is a theme-based examination designed to test how well the test taker can communicate in English in real-life and authentic situations of life. The test is generally taken only for the purpose of improving in the English language. Only a few countries accept the PTE General score for admission purpose.

PTE Academic

Pearson Test of English, Academic (PTE Academic) was launched in 2009 which is endorsed by the Graduate Management Admission Council (GMAC). PTE Academic Test is a computer-based examination designed to assess the exam takers readiness to undertake a university program from a native English speaking country. Most of the universities accept the PTE Academic score for admission purpose.

PTE Young Learners

Pearson Test of English for Younger Learners (PTE Young Learners) formerly known as London Tests of English for Children. The test is designed to assess the ability of children who are learning English as a foreign language.

PTE Exam Pattern 2020 

The PTE test is made of the following components:

  • Question – Time to Reading the Text Prompt: The time duration of each prompt you get varies depending upon the length of the text. The length is measurable in words or sentences. You need to be active in this part.
  • Prepare for Answer – Time granted to Relax and Think: You do not have to immediately answer the question. On average, you get 10 to 15 seconds to prepare for each segment. You should relax and think for a while on how to answer.
  • Answer – Time for Action: This is the total time duration where you have to perform. The answers are recorded when you speak, saved as text when you write, and selected in options multiple-choice questions.

Refer to the segment-wise description boxes given along with each section explaining the PTE Exam Pattern 2020 in detail:

Speaking and Writing — 77 to 93 minutes

As the name implies, this section tests the candidate’s on the basis of their 2 major skills of communication, which are spoken and written skills. This section comprises of six small sections that test you on your promptness over speaking and writing the written test that you would get to read for the first time ever. The complete section is given time duration of 77 to 93 minutes and the time allotted to each segment is as follows:

Segments PatternTime Duration
Personal Introduction          55 seconds: 25 seconds for prompt, 30 seconds to record
Read Aloud30-40 seconds to prepare for reading out the text of 60 words
Repeat Sentence15 seconds: 3-9 seconds for prompt, 15 seconds to record
Describe Image25 seconds are granted to study the image as well as prepare your response on the same
Re-Tell Lecture90 seconds for prompt length, 10 seconds to prepare and 40 seconds to answer
Answer Short Question20 seconds: 3-9 seconds for prompt, 10 seconds to answer
Summarize Written Text10 minutes to answer to text prompt of 300 words
Essay20 minutes to answer to text prompt of 2-3 sentences

Reading — 32 to 41 minutes

This section tests the candidates on the basis of their ability to understand the written instructions in the language. The section further divided into 5 segments is 32 to 41 minutes long. Check out the segment-wise pattern for time distribution of this section:

Segments PatternTime Duration varies on the length of the Text Prompt
Multiple Choice, Choose Single AnswerRead 300 words of text
Multiple Choice, Choose Multiple AnswersRead 300 words of text
Re-Order ParagraphsRead 150 words of text
Reading: Fill in the BlanksRead 80 words of text
Reading and Writing: Fill in the BlanksRead 300 words of text

Listening — 45 to 57 minutes

The listening section of the PTE Academic is stretched over 45 to 57 minutes of duration. This one is designed to determine the ability to understand spoken English by the candidate. Here, the student needs to ascertain that they carefully hear the audio file played and retain what they heard. This section is divided into 8 segments and the time give to each segment is as follows.

Segments PatternTime Duration
Summarize Spoken Text60-90 seconds to retain  50-70 words, 10 minutes to write
Multiple Choice, Multiple Answer40-90 seconds for prompt
Fill in the Blanks30-60 seconds
Highlight Correct Summary30-90 seconds
Multiple Choice, Single Answer30-60 seconds
Select Missing Word20-70 seconds
Highlight Incorrect Words15-50 seconds
Write From Dictation3-5 seconds

What are the eligibility criteria for the PTE Academic Exam?

As such, there are no specific criteria set by the Pearson PLC Group – the conducting body of the PTE Academic exam. However, according to the PTE Academic eligibility criteria, students must be at least 16 years of age at the time of appearing for the test. Also, candidates who are below 18 years of age need to give a parental consent form for appearing for the PTE Academic test.

Age Limit to Appear for PTE Academic Exam

In order to take the PTE Academic test, the candidate must be at least 16 years old. Candidates below 18 years of age need to take a parental consent form signed by either parents or guardians before taking the test. Candidates can download the consent form from the official website of the PTE Academic Exam. 

Education Qualification to appear for PTE Academic Exam?

Pearson PLC Group – the conducting body of the PTE Academic Exam has not laid down any education qualification criteria for candidates wanting to appear for the PTE Academic test.

How to Cancel or Reschedule PTE Exam?

If you don’t want to appear for the PTE Academic test, then you can claim a refund before 14 calendar days before the test date. Canceling or rescheduling the PTE Academic exam can be done on the PTE official website. Candidates can reschedule the PTE exam 2020 to any other date through phone or online. You can read more about the Cancellation and Rescheduling PTE Academic fee below.

PTE Exam Cancellation Fees

Candidates who decide on not pursuing their PTE Academic test after booking their exam online have up to 14 calendar days before their test date to claim a full refund. Candidates who cancel the test, with less than 14 calendar days, but at least 7 calendar days before their test date will receive a partial refund of 50% of the test fee paid. However, no refunds would be provided to candidates on canceling the exam less than 7 calendar days before the exam. Candidates should note that cancellation and reschedule policy does not include your test date.

PTE Rescheduling Fees

Candidates who plan to reschedule the test, with less than 14 calendar days, but at least 7 full calendar days before their test date will be required to pay 50% of the test fee. No refunds will be provided on rescheduling the exam less than 7 calendar days before the exam. Candidates should note that the reschedule policy does not include your test date.

PTE Test Accommodations/ Special Arrangements

Committed to providing access for all individuals with disabilities, test accommodations also known as “special arrangements” or “reasonable adjustments” are made available by Pearson VUE to make the test assessable to everyone. Arrangements made possible include,

  • A separate testing room
  • Extra testing time
  • A Reader or Recorder

How do I request a test accommodation?

Candidates who require special arrangements need to specify their needs and how the disability is hindering them from performing their best under standard conditions. Candidates would have to provide documentation proof and apply weeks in advance for the conducting body to make the required arrangements. Candidates are required to apply for the request before they book their exam.

PTE Results and Score

PTE Academic Results are usually available online within five working days from the test date. The PTE Academic results are issued online. And can be accessed from your PTE Academic student account. First, you will receive an email within five working days with instructions on accessing the results online. After that, you need to follow the instructions to log in to your Pearson account.  You can share your results with the colleges and universities of your choice through your Pearson account.

PTE Academic Exam is scored on a scale of 10 – 90 where 10 is lowest, with increments of 1 point. Graded on the scale, the score showcase the person’s ability to read, speak, understand verbal instructions and write the English language. The scores are presented in a graph, giving an easy understanding of the candidate’s core skills in the language as well as improvement areas.

How to Send PTE Score Report?

Candidates who wish to send their score can do so via an online secure portal set up by PTE. Universities do not accept paper or PDF versions of PTE Academic score reports.

Steps to sending your PTE Score Report

  • Login to your account.
  • Click ‘View Score Reports’.
  • Click ‘Send Scores’.
  • Type the name of your chosen institution
  • Review your details then scroll down the page and click ‘Next’ and then ‘Next’ again to confirm

Rescoring the Score?

If candidates are unsatisfied with their PTE Score they can request a rescore. However, since the PTE Academic is a computer-scored test, the chance of an error is highly minimalized. Only spoken responses and open-ended written responses are rescored. Candidates can only request a rescore for their most recent PTE Academic Test and candidates are barred from requesting a rescore if they have already either scheduled another test or sent their score to an institution. In the event the score changes, the new score will replace the previous score and the original score report will be reissued to reflect the new score.

PTE Results – Check PTE Academic Score here

After the completion of your PTE Academic exam, you will receive PTE Academic scores for each for the skill sections on a band range of 10 – 90. Along with that, you will also get an overall score. See the scoring pattern below to understand what does each range of score means – 

PTE Academic Score  Level Description 
Above 85 Can understand with ease virtually everything heard or read. Can summarize information from different spoken and written sources, reconstructing arguments and accounts in a coherent presentation. Can express him/herself spontaneously, very fluently and precisely, differentiating finer shades of meaning even in more complex situations.  
76 – 84 Can understand a wide range of demanding, longer texts and recognize implicit meaning. Can express him/herself fluently and spontaneously without much obvious searching for expressions. Can use language flexibly and effectively for social, academic and professional purposes. Can produce clear, well-structured, detailed text on complex subjects, showing controlled use of organizational patterns, connectors, and cohesive devices. 
59 – 75 Can understand the main ideas of complex text on both concrete and abstract topics, including technical discussions in his/her field of specialization. Can interact with a degree of oral fluency and spontaneity that makes regular interaction with native speakers quite possible without strain for either party. Can produce clear, detailed text on a wide range of subjects and explain a viewpoint on a topical issue giving the advantages and disadvantages of various options. 
51 – 58 Has sufficient command of the language to deal with most familiar situations, but will often require repetition and make many mistakes. Can deal with standard spoken language, but will have problems in noisy circumstances. Can exchange factual information on a familiar routine and non-routine matters within his/her field with some confidence. Can pass on a detailed piece of information reliably. Can understand the information content of the majority of recorded or broadcast material on topics of personal interest delivered in clear standard speech.  
43 – 58 Can understand the main points of clear standard input on familiar matters regularly encountered in work, school, leisure, etc. Can deal with most situations likely to arise whilst in an area where the language is spoken. Can produce simple connected text on topics, which are familiar or of personal interest. Can describe experiences and events, dreams, hopes, and ambitions and briefly give reasons and explanations for opinions and plans.  
30 – 42 Can understand sentences and frequently used expressions related to areas of most immediate relevance (e.g., very basic personal and family information, shopping, local geography, employment). Can communicate in simple and routine tasks requiring a simple and direct exchange of information on familiar and routine matters. Can describe in simple terms aspects of his/her background, immediate environment, and matters in areas of immediate need.  
10 – 29 Can understand and use familiar everyday expressions and very basic phrases aimed at the satisfaction of needs of a concrete type. Can introduce him/herself and others and can ask and answer questions about personal details such as where he/she lives, people he/she knows and things he/she has. Can interact in a simple way provided the other person talks slowly and clearly and is prepared to help.
